Roll-out: Liebherr-Aerospace on board the Falcon 5X

02/06/2015

Press releaseIssued by Liebherr-Aerospace Toulouse.

Liebherr-Aerospace supplies critical systems for Dassault Aviation's new-generation business jet Falcon 5X, which was unveiled to the public at the aircraft manufacturer's facility in Bordeaux-Merignac (France) on June 2, 2015.

The company's share in this two-engine aircraft comprises the integrated air management system and the cabin air humidification system. Liebherr-Aerospace Toulouse SAS, Liebherr's center of excellence for air management systems based in Toulouse (France), has leveraged its many years of experience to develop and manufacture light-weight and reliable components for both devices; for over 50 years, the system supplier has been manufacturing critical flight systems for all of Dassault Aviation's aircraft, including other members of the Falcon family such as the Falcon 7X, Falcon 8X, Falcon 900, Falcon 2000 and Falcon 50 models.

Liebherr-Aerospace will offer support solutions for its components and systems on board the Falcon 5X during the business jet's entire life cycle. Thanks to its international network of maintenance, repair and overhaul stations and spares distribution facilities, the company's customer service organization ensures customer proximity and high-level performance for aircraft operators across the world.
